Women's handball club in Bistrița-Năsăud, Romania From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
CS Gloria 2018 Bistrița-Năsăud, commonly known as Gloria Bistrița and colloquially as Gloria, is a professional women's handball club based in Bistrița, Bistrița-Năsăud, Transylvania, Romania, that competes in the Liga Naţională and the EHF Champions League.

Gloria were runners-up in the 2023–24 EHF European League.
